Welcome aboard! Quick context for your review of Quillmark, our markdown rendering pipeline at Fennelworks. Raw markdown goes through the sanitizer, then the renderer, then a final escape pass — nothing user-supplied touches the DOM directly. Staging runs behind the Bramble gateway, so you'll need recovery access to poke at the sandbox. To get into the sandboxed reviewer account, use the passphrase that follows.

unlock words, fadug-tageg: zorix-wenwyn-quenmir

- [ ] Step 7: Archive cold storage buckets (Glacierline tier). Confirm both ceremony witnesses are present, verify bucket manifests match the Oxbow ledger, then seal the archive key shares. Plugin authors may observe but not handle shares. Once sealed, the archive index itself is encrypted and can only be reopened with the passphrase below.

vault phrase of badup-hahig = tamael-aldael-kelmir-istael-fenok-istwyn-tamius-jorath-oliion

Runbook — Glimmerpath Uploads. When a text file fails encoding detection, the sniffer in Harkwell falls back to UTF-8 with replacement, which can silently corrupt ledger imports. Check the detection confidence score first; anything below 0.6 warrants manual review. If you must escalate, attach the detector's build token, shown below.

pipeline stamp: htk21_0e1a1ddcdb5bfd88d6dd6

Finance folks, as promised: Venlor Group sent over their term sheet for the co-manufacturing deal on the Sable line. Headline terms look workable — 60/40 capex split, five-year commitment, volume floors that we can realistically hit. The sticking point is the exclusivity clause covering the Northreach market, which legal is still chewing on. We'd like a sensitivity model on the volume floors before the next steering call. Please treat all figures as draft. The wider rationale is captured in the note below.

confidential, kagap-yagef: The finance team signed off on a budget of $467.8 million for Project Aldok.

**14:22 — Pickwise optimizer degraded**

Routegrain warehouse nodes began returning stale pick sequences. Cause: Pickwise cached zone weights from the aborted 14:05 deploy. On-call rolled back, flushed the weight cache, and confirmed fresh sequences within six minutes. No orders lost; eleven were re-picked manually. Lesson for new folks: always flush the cache after any rollback. The rollback artifact is identified by the token below.

session token of yahof-bajeg = htk9_0d43d44ed